For the lore page, see Shiren:Chintala Family.

The Chintala (Japanese: チンタラ, Chintara Kei) Monster Family in Nintendo DS Mystery Dungeon: Shiren the Wanderer consists of:

  1. Chintala (Japanese: チンタラ, Chintara)
  2. Mid Chintala (Japanese: ちゅうチンタラ, Chūchintara)
  3. Big Chintala (Japanese: おおチンタラ, Ōchintara)
  4. Giga Chintala (Japanese: とくだいチンタラ, Tokudai Chintara)

These monsters have a body resembling a plump white circle with cat ears and have features resembling a :3 face. They have small feet and a long cat tail behind them. Depending on the monster's level, the feet, inner ears, and tip of the tail change color:

  • 1-olive green
  • 2-blue
  • 3-orange
  • 4-grey

When attacking, Chintala Family Monsters jump up and bump into their target before landing back in their initial position.

Combat Strategy

When first encountered on floors 1 - 4 of Table Mountain, Chintalas are slightly stronger than other monsters found there, Mamel and Mini Robber. This is not an extreme difference but should be taken note of when surrounded, weaker monsters, that can be defeated by one hit should be defeated first, rather than attacking the Chintala, and be attacked by both the Mamel and Chintala in that same turn.

Being a weak melee-type monster with no special abilities, there aren't many precautions to be taken when fighting these monsters (level one Chintala Family monsters even appear on the first floors of dungeons). At higher levels though, as HP and damage increase much like other monster families, normal precautions such as a strong Weapon and Shield are recommended.

Alternatively, Monster Meat of an even weaker monster can be thrown to transform the enemy into a more easily defeated form.

Meat Strategy

With no unique abilities, there is no specific benefit to Shiren consuming Chintala Family Monster Meat. Instead, low-level meat can be thrown to transform other monsters into a more easily defeated form. However, there is a chance that the Meat will miss, so it is best to do this at a distance and/or not to rely on it. There are some benefits to consuming any monster meat in general:

  • Eating any Monster Meat will increase fullness by 10 points with the exception of Hen Family Meat, which will restore fullness by 100 points.
  • As a monster, items in Shiren's inventory cannot be accessed and therefore items cannot be: equipped, unequipped, put down, thrown, eaten, dropped, Projectiles, inserted or removed from Jars and jars also cannot be pressed.
  • When transforming or reverting into a monster, all Status Abnormalities can be cured, however statuses that prevent the player from acting to perform these actions cannot conventionally be cured in any way.
